The Trex TS-IM-G-5.48 Grooved Board in Island Mist offers a sleek, modern finish with the convenience of a hidden fastening system. made from 95% recycled materials, this board resists fading, stains, and scratches, while remaining easy to clean with just soap and water. with a 50-year warranty, it?s a durable, eco-friendly solution for your deck.

Trex composite decking is built to last for decades, typically offering a 25-year lifespan or longer with proper care. The material is resistant to many of the issues that affect traditional wood, such as warping, rotting, and splintering.
Trex recommends using screws designed for composite decking, such as those made from stainless steel or coated to resist corrosion. Avoid using regular wood screws as they can cause splitting or rust.
Yes, Trex can be used for fascia applications. It is important to use Trex fascia boards designed for this purpose to maintain the aesthetic and durability of your deck's edges.
Trex composite decking has a Class B fire rating, which means it is resistant to fire spread, making it a safer option for many residential applications. However, it is not entirely fireproof.
Trex composite decking consists of a blend of recycled wood fibres and plastic, providing a durable, eco-friendly material. The decking is capped with a protective layer that helps prevent stains and fading while also making it low maintenance.
